Cydia Dev Discloses Ethereum L2 Bug — Optimism Attacker Could Have 'Printed an Arbitrary Quantity of Tokens'
On February 10, the well-known developer of Cydia and iOS Jailbreak, Jay Freeman, otherwise known as Saurik, published a Twitter thread about a bug he found in the Layer-2 (L2) scaling protocol known as Optimism. According to Freeman, the vulnerability, which has been patched, could have allowed an attacker to create an infinite amount of tokens.

Hungary's Central Bank Governor Calls for EU-Wide Ban on Cryptocurrency Trading and Mining
The governor of Hungary’s central bank has called for a ban on cryptocurrency trading and mining in the European Union. “It is clear-cut that cryptocurrencies could service illegal activities and tend to build up financial pyramids,” he said.

Wells Fargo: Cryptocurrency Has Entered 'Hyper-Adoption Phase'
Financial services firm Wells Fargo says that cryptocurrencies are viable investments that have entered the “hyper-adoption” phase. “Cryptocurrencies have been following an adoption pattern similar to other new advanced technologies, such as the internet,” the firm’s global investment team detailed.

Netflix Orders Crypto Series About a Couple's Alleged Scheme to Launder $4.5B in Bitcoin Stolen From Bitfinex
Netflix has ordered a documentary series about the couple who allegedly laundered billions of dollars from the 2016 Bitfinex hack. Aspiring rapper Heather Morgan and her husband, Ilya “Dutch” Lichtenstein, were arrested in New York this week. The Department of Justice (DOJ) also seized 94,636 bitcoins stolen from the Bitfinex hack.

Super Bowl And Crypto – Athletes Cashing on Digital Currencies
This weekend, you can get ready for the “Crypto Bowl.” For the first time, advertisements for cryptocurrency firms are anticipated to dominate the commercial breaks during the year’s most important athletic event. Several cryptocurrency exchanges, including Coinbase, EToro, Crypto.com, and FTX, would likely air advertising during the Super Bowl on Sunday.
